Generational Equity Advises Control Design & Manufacturing in its Sale to Columbia PSI


Generational Equity, a leading mergers and acquisitions advisor for privately held businesses, is pleased to announce the sale of its client Control Design & Manufacturing, Inc. to Columbia PSI, LLC. The acquisition closed April 1, 2022.

Located in Englewood, Colorado, Control Design & Manufacturing, Inc. (CD&M) is a recognized leader in factory automation solutions, designing, manufacturing, and supporting conventional bag palletizing systems, bag handling equipment, box forming and filling solutions and controls. CD&M will become part of Columbia PSI, LLC and all employees have been hired, allowing the business to carry on without missing a day of operation or sacrificing customer commitment.

Columbia PSI (Columbia) located in Vancouver, Washington is one of the world's leading manufacturers of concrete products equipment, serving customers in over 100 countries. From mixing and batching to automatic cubing and splitting, Columbia builds a complete line of equipment to outfit an entire concrete products plant.

Columbia PSI, LLC. will join its extensive bagging product lines with CD&M's wide range of equipment solutions. The addition of the CD&M palletizing solutions, accessory conveyors, controls, box forming equipment, and years of experience will further grow Columbia PSI as an innovative, industry leader.
